tips for not having a fire: check all your rubber fuel lines and replace them, probs about 20 quid in fuel line, also check the clutch cable hasnt rubbed over the fuel pump ontop of the engine too much, as this can cause it to leak…most importantly check that the rubber gasket in between the carb is secure, with no splits etc…worth replacing, abotu 12 quid.(mine was brand new)
as for respray, thats like asking how camp is dale winton? depends what you want…
a GOOD respray with an oven bake finish, with a little bit of welding and generally what it takes to bring a car up to a standard where it is ready to paint, you are looking at about 2-2.5k for a really good job
my advice is strip literally everything minus the dashboard, sand down all the inside, get it in primer, and if you think you are any good, prep the outside too, the more prep you do, the less it will cost, as the prep is the timely part!

from alternator 1 x big lead to starter then from starter to battery
battery earth to chassis leg then gearbox
the black lean inside maybe the rev counter wire?
if it spins over then struggles id say timing plug leads around the wrong way not an earth issue
i think your pretty much there just a couple of wires to swap and check timing did you take the dizzy right out or just the cap

not silly but if you didnt put it back in the same position it will throw the timing out
im not sure if you can put it back in wrong but you can twist it so its out like whenyou advance retard the timing
so jobs for tommorow
time engine up and see where rotor arm points then loosen dizzy and adjust so plug position one points to rotaor arm if needed
rewire coil
fire up and drive away 8)
